Output 84e75a91eadeba33adc6e96bd9174946439b69f1cf236fc16e0f9b329c56de22:1

value
9086819
script pubkey
OP_0 OP_PUSHBYTES_20 ddcdb461ebe5f903d83ff7571b81245a059adfb7
address
bc1qmhxmgc0tuhus8kpl7at3hqfytgze4hahscgmsz
transaction
84e75a91eadeba33adc6e96bd9174946439b69f1cf236fc16e0f9b329c56de22